43 providers in Cardiovascular Surgery, Cerebrovascular & Skull Base Surgery, Dermatology, Vascular Surgery

43 providers in Cardiovascular Surgery, Cerebrovascular & Skull Base Surgery, Dermatology, Vascular Surgery